A 1 kW solar panel typically generates between 1,200 and 1,600 kilowatt-hours (kWh) of electricity per year, depending on various factors. The exact amount is influenced by geographical location, weather conditions, and the efficiency of the solar panel system itself. . For 1 kWh per day, you would need about a 300-watt solar panel. If we know both the solar panel size and peak sun hours at our location, we can calculate how many kilowatts does a solar panel produce per day using this equation: Daily kWh. .
